With double hung windows, the two sashes in the frame are operable. With a single hung window, the top sash in the frame is stationary while the bottom sash in the frame is operable. Here’s a look at some of the pros and cons of double hung windows.

Pros

Options: While vinyl windows are the most popular type of window, double hung windows are the most popular style of window. You can therefore expect to find all sorts of double hung window colors. So if you’re the picky sort who has to have everything looking just so, you’ll be well served with double hung windows. In addition to different color options, you can choose double hung windows in different materials like vinyl and wood.

Ventilation: With double hung windows, you can get air flow in your home by opening up the sashes. Ventilation is better with double hung windows — where there are two operable sashes — than with single hung windows — where only one of the two sashes is operable. Also consider that a double hung window is a good pick if you plan to install a window air conditioner at some point.

Cons

Maintenance: Any replacement window will require some level of maintenance. With double hung windows, you’ll need to lubricate the tracks so that the sash slides or glides with minimal effort on your part. However, you’ll typically only need to do hardware maintenance once annually. Another maintenance issue to be mindful of is the spring used to ensure that the sash stays put when you raise or lower it. The spring can sometimes fail, but that can easily be remedied by swapping out the faulty one and replacing it with a new one.

Air Leaks Possible Over Time: Double hung windows are great, but they don’t rank as high as some other types of windows when it comes to airtightness. What this means is that double hung windows, as they get older, sometimes develop air leaks. You will be able to combat some of these problems with some caulking or weatherstripping.

While there are pros and cons with most any product, you won’t have made a bad choice if you go with double hung windows for your home. It just might be the case, however, that some window types are more suitable than others for your home or for certain rooms in your home.
